The United States imposed sanctions against the leader of the hacker group LockBit

The United States, Great Britain and Australia have imposed sanctions against one of the leaders of the LockBit hacker group, Russian Dmitry Khoroshev. About it reported on the British government website.

LockBit attacked more than 200 British businesses and major government service providers, the report said. The group was responsible for extorting more than $1 billion from thousands of victims around the world.

“The Lock Bit group has orchestrated a malicious online campaign to illegally steal and use sensitive data to extract billions of dollars from businesses and individuals,” the report said.

Sanctions include freezing assets if they are discovered and a ban on entry.

In addition, the US State Department announced a reward of up to $10 million for information leading to the identification or location of key leaders of the LockBit group and those involved in its activities.

  • In February, the NCA, the US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), Europol and the National Police of Ukraine announced in a joint statement the destruction of LockBit’s infrastructure, as well as arrests made in Ukraine and Poland in connection with the case.
  • Soon the hacker group announced that they had managed to restore the operation of their servers. However, according to the NCA, the group is now operating with limited capabilities, and the global threat from LockBit has been significantly reduced.
